Hosts = end systems
Communication links
Transmission rate : bandwidth
Packet switches
packet : 요청과 응답이 오가는 과정의 데이터들이 잘라져서 보내짐. 이때 잘라진 단위를 packet이라함. 신호를 넘겨주는 switch들은 packet단위로 보내줌
forward packet (chunks of data)
Routers and switches
global ISP : 다양한 국가들을 연결
regional ISP : 지역별 컴퓨터들이 연결
Protocols
Control sending and receiving of messages
e.g. TCP, IP, HTTP, Skype, 802.11
Internet standards
인터넷은 표준임(표준은 철저히 테스트를 해놓은 것임)
Thoroughly tested specification
Formalized regulation that must be followed
RFC : Request for comments
IETF : Internet Engineering Task Force
network protocol
computer - TCP connection request → server
computer ← TCP connection response - server
computer - Get http://www.awl.com → server
Internet Administration
ISOC(Internet Society) - IAB(Internet Architecture Board) - IRTF(IRSG-RG) / IETF(IESG-Area-WG)
Internet에서 protocol의 역할이 무엇인지?
어떻게 보낼 것이며 언제 보낼건지, 어떻게 응답하고 어떻게 요청하는지를 정해주는 약속
각각의 서버에 접속하기 위해 공통으로 해야하는 일을 구분
인터넷의 입장에서 소프트웨어
둘 이상의 엔터티들이 성공적으로 상호작용하는 방법
Protocols define format, order of msgs sent and received among network netities and actions taken on msg transmission, receipt
protocol은 국가간의 외교 절차, 병원에서의 진료 절차 등. 인터넷에 국한되지 않음. 오랫동안 해왔던 관습을 의미함.